Output 80583f8d664375ffad2a096b2c8abdaee173b3bf21726866e68c961033d14bbc: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ba65b45876a62ecab177af44c59a1d4032e784e4 OP_EQUAL
address
3JgbSmuPEH8ANJkpw2R1eL8qoQKyg3uwEN
transaction
80583f8d664375ffad2a096b2c8abdaee173b3bf21726866e68c961033d14bbc